• Arizona kids will get a chance to learn how do more than just sell lemonade from the sidewalk Saturday at the AZ Children’s Business Fair. The one-day event at the Arizona Center in downtown Phoenix is for 6-to-14-year-olds with business ideas. The showcase runs from 10 a.m. to 1 p.m.
